2025: Launch of Mass Production

On November 26, 2025, on the day of the opening of the new shipbuilding enterprise Moskovskaya Verf, the keels of the Moscow 1.0 passenger electric ships with a capacity of 56 people were laid. Electric vessels are designed to operate on regular river routes.

This was reported by the press service of the Moscow government. The production capacity of the shipyard allows the production of up to 40 ships per year. The company is capable of simultaneously assembling ships of various types: electric ships of the Moscow series (1.0, 2.0, 3.0), the Moscow Golden Ring cruise ship, as well as unmanned boats to patrol the waters of the Moscow River.

In the coming years, the Moscow government plans to purchase about 40 modern electric ships. The relevance of this project is due to the need to update the pleasure fleet: during the summer navigation period, more than 130 ships with an average service life of about 40 years are involved. The organization of the production of electric ships "Moscow 3.0" with a capacity of 150-250 passengers will significantly speed up this process.

For 2027, it is planned to lay a modern hybrid cruise ship "Moscow Golden Ring" 110 m long to work on the tourist route of the same name.

By 2030, it is projected to launch seven regular river electric transport routes, which will serve 67 new ships, and 11 excursion and pleasure routes with 42 electric ships. The total fleet of electric ships produced by the Moscow Shipyard will exceed 100 units.

The implementation of the project will increase the annual passenger traffic by river transport to 7 million people, of which 4 million will be on regular routes. Passenger traffic will cover the entire water area of ​ ​ the Moscow River within the city.[1]
